A speeding ticket for driving 15 miles over the speed limit is a criminal violation in Arkansas. This can result in a serious fine, raised insurance rates, and a permanent stain on your driving record. Hiring a defense attorney early allows you to fight for a civil penalty, thus avoiding those issues.
